mgunjan / KubeflowDojo

Repository to hold code, instructions, demos and pointers to presentation assets for Kubeflow Dojo

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Kubeflow Dojo

Repository to hold code, instructions, demos and pointers to presentation assets for Kubeflow Dojo. In this Dojo, we are going to address how to make it easy for everyone to develop, deploy, and manage portable, scalable ML everywhere and support the full lifecycle Machine Learning using Kubeflow. We are going to discuss how to deploy and manage Kubeflow, and detail how to enable distributed training of models, model serving, canary rollouts, drift detection, model explainability, metadata management, pipelines and others.

To enable developers who want to use it at their own pace, pre-recorded sessions are uploaded. For those who prefer live interactions, we will be running the sessions and workshops live.

Read about IBM's journey with Kuebflow here

kubeflow-dojo

Live Schedule and Prereqs

When: July 15th and 16th. All times listed are in PST time zone

Wed July 15, 2020: End to end presentation and walk through on Kubeflow, followed by detailed deep dive and hands on deploying Kubeflow to Minikube and/or IBM Cloud Kubernetes Service (IKS).

Thu July 16, 2020: Deeper dive sessions and demos on Kubeflow Pipelines, Kubeflow Serving (KFServing), Distributed Training Operators and HPO, and Kubeflow PR workflow

Where: Please register at the following link: http://ibm.biz/KubeflowDojo

The Kubeflow Slack workspace is kubeflow.slack.com. To join, click this invitation to Kubeflow Slack workspace. There is a channel #kubeflow-dojo created for the workshop.

Prereqs: Please look at prereqs here

Date: Wed July 15, 2020

Time Topic Presenter Links
8:00am - 8:20 am Trusted and Responsible AI through Open Source Animesh
8:20am - 9:30am Basics of Git and Github Morgan Bauer Link
Videos
9:30am - 10:45 am Kubeflow - End to end ML on Kubernetes Animesh Kubeflow End to End
10:45am - 11:00am Break
11:00am - 11:30am Kubeflow Development Environment Weiqiang Slides
Video
11:30am - 12:00 pm Kubeflow Control Plane deep dive Weiqiang Slides
Video
12:00pm - 1:00pm Lunch break
1:00pm - 2:30pm Kubeflow Deployment Hands On Weiqiang, Shawn, Tommy Deployment on IKS
Deployment on minikube
2:30am - 2:45am Break
2:45pm - 3:30pm Tryout Kubeflow Components Tommy Hands On Notebook
3:30pm - 4:00pm Q&A

Date: Thu July 16, 2020

Time Topic Presenter Links
8:00am - 8:30am Overview of Kubeflow repos Tommy Slides
8:30 am - 9:30am Kubeflow Pipelines deep dive Animesh, Tommy, Christian Slides
Video
9:30am - 9:45am Break
9:45 am - 10:45am Kubeflow Pipelines-Tekton hands on Christian Kadner, Tommy Li KFP with Tekton
10:45am - 11 am Break
11:00am - 12 am KFServing deep dive Animesh, Tommy Slides
Video
12:00pm - 1:00pm Lunch break
1:00pm - 2:00pm Distributed Training and HPO Deep Dive Andrew, Kevin, Animesh Slides
Video
2:00pm - 2:15pm Break
2:15pm - 2:30pm Kubeflow PR workflow Weiqiang Slides
Video
2:30pm - 3:30pm PR workflow handson PR workflow
3:30pm - 4:00pm Wrap up and final Q&A Animesh

About

Repository to hold code, instructions, demos and pointers to presentation assets for Kubeflow Dojo

License:Apache License 2.0


Languages

Language:Jupyter Notebook 99.7%Language:Python 0.3%